Title :  CRYSTAL STRUCTURE OF LEUT BOUND TO L-SELENOMETHIONINE IN SPACE GROUP C2 FROM LIPID BICELLES
 
Authors :  H. Wang, J. Elferich, E. Gouaux
Date :  23 Nov 11  (Deposition) - 11 Jan 12  (Release) - 29 Feb 12  (Revision)
Method :  X-RAY DIFFRACTION
Resolution :  2.71
Chains :  Asym. Unit :  A
Biol. Unit 1:  A  (1x)
Biol. Unit 2:  A  (2x)
Keywords :  Leucine Transporter, Transport Protein (Keyword Search: [Gene Ontology, PubMed, Web (Google))
 
Reference :  H. Wang, J. Elferich, E. Gouaux
Structures Of Leut In Bicelles Define Conformation And Substrate Binding In A Membrane-Like Context.
Nat. Struct. Mol. Biol. V. 19 212 2012
PubMed-ID: 22245965  |  Reference-DOI: 10.1038/NSMB.2215

(-) Gene Ontology  (9, 9)

Asymmetric Unit(hide GO term definitions)
Chain A   (O67854_AQUAE | O67854)
molecular function
    GO:0005328    neurotransmitter:sodium symporter activity    Catalysis of the transfer of a solute or solutes from one side of a membrane to the other according to the reaction: neurotransmitter(out) + Na+(out) = neurotransmitter(in) + Na+(in).
    GO:0015293    symporter activity    Enables the active transport of a solute across a membrane by a mechanism whereby two or more species are transported together in the same direction in a tightly coupled process not directly linked to a form of energy other than chemiosmotic energy.
    GO:0005215    transporter activity    Enables the directed movement of substances (such as macromolecules, small molecules, ions) into, out of or within a cell, or between cells.
biological process
    GO:0006836    neurotransmitter transport    The directed movement of a neurotransmitter into, out of or within a cell, or between cells, by means of some agent such as a transporter or pore. Neurotransmitters are any chemical substance that is capable of transmitting (or inhibiting the transmission of) a nerve impulse from a neuron to another cell.
    GO:0055085    transmembrane transport    The process in which a solute is transported across a lipid bilayer, from one side of a membrane to the other
    GO:0006810    transport    The directed movement of substances (such as macromolecules, small molecules, ions) or cellular components (such as complexes and organelles) into, out of or within a cell, or between cells, or within a multicellular organism by means of some agent such as a transporter, pore or motor protein.
cellular component
    GO:0016021    integral component of membrane    The component of a membrane consisting of the gene products and protein complexes having at least some part of their peptide sequence embedded in the hydrophobic region of the membrane.
    GO:0005887    integral component of plasma membrane    The component of the plasma membrane consisting of the gene products and protein complexes having at least some part of their peptide sequence embedded in the hydrophobic region of the membrane.
    GO:0016020    membrane    A lipid bilayer along with all the proteins and protein complexes embedded in it an attached to it.
